Conveyor

Conveyor belts are machines used to automatically transport materials or goods from one point to another. They are commonly used in manufacturing, logistics, and warehousing industries to increase speed and reduce manual labor in material handling systems.

Conveyor systems improve production efficiency by transporting materials or products continuously without stopping, reducing the time it takes to move goods from one point to another within a factory. Furthermore, they reduce labor costs by using machinery instead of human labor, thus reducing the need for a large workforce. They also reduce the risk of injury from heavy lifting or improper handling, effectively preventing workplace accidents.

Conveyor systems can handle a wide variety of materials, including solids, liquids, fine powders, and mechanical components. They can be installed horizontally, inclined, or vertically, depending on the application. They are easy to control and can be equipped with automation or sensors to control the speed and direction of material flow. Conveyor systems also save space, as they can be designed to operate overhead or at height, leaving the work area free from obstructions.
